For a limited time only this school holidays, we're offering a special, family-focused guided experience within Māori Court, for Mandarin speakers. This tour is perfect for families wanting an educational, fun learning experience that strengthens the Mandarin language abilities of their kids.
Led by our Mandarin-speaking Volunteer Guide, this tour will introduce you to one of the most significant collections of Māori artefacts in the world, with over 1,000 taonga (treasures) on display. You're welcome to ask questions throughout.
The tour will end in our newly renovated Te Ao Mārama, South Atrium where you'll receive a complimentary activity sheet in Mandarin, to keep exploring more of the Museum together.
